Q: The string-extraction script (polyglot-pull) fails with "locale bundle locked" during release cut. What now?

A: This happens when a prior run died mid-extraction and left the Fennwick locale vault sealed. Don't delete the lockfile. Run polyglot-pull --unseal from the release host; it will ask for the bundle recovery passphrase. Re-run extraction afterward and diff against the previous bundle. The passphrase you need is below.

unlock words, hahip-baduf: holwyn-istath-julvan

Handover for tonight — Lumenreach report exports. Heads up: the timezone bug strikes again. Exports scheduled by tenants in half-hour-offset zones are rendering timestamps shifted by 30 minutes because the formatter rounds the UTC offset. Priya patched the renderer but the fix only takes effect after a config reload, which I haven't done on prod yet. Current export service config for reference.

service settings:
[casax]
port = 6379
team = rusir
host = casax.zemvarhq.corp
region = outer-4
access_code = ac_9808ce
timeout_ms = 1500

## Timetabler Environments

The Gridwise timetable solver runs in three environments: dev, staging, and prod. Dev uses a reduced constraint set so solves finish in under a minute; staging mirrors prod data from Northvale Academy's anonymized dump. Prod solves run nightly and on-demand via the scheduler queue. Reviewers should confirm changes against staging before approving merges, since solver heuristics behave differently at full scale. The staging instance currently runs with the following configuration values.

settings of bafof-fajog:
[aldix]
port = 9300
region = north-3
host = aldix.kelvilabs.example
team = istath
timeout_ms = 1500
retries = 8

Action item: The Relayn deploy-status bot silently dropped updates when the pipeline API paginated results, so responders believed a rollback had completed when it had not. We will add pagination handling, a staleness banner, and an integration test. Until merged, verify deploy state directly in the pipeline console, documented at the page below.

runbook for kahop-kajop: https://rundeck.ordinio.test/display/secrets/pipeline/issue/pages/repo/browse/e5732776e07d1285107e5aeb